AI Technical Summary
Existing track bed vibration reduction technology is not effective in some track sections, and improving vibration reduction capacity requires high costs. Furthermore, existing resonators fail to effectively utilize the synergistic effect of multiple track bed slabs.
Design an integrated resonator for rail transit. By setting connectors and elastic layers between mass plates, a collaborative resonant unit of multiple mass plates is formed. The resonant mass is increased by using connection methods such as mortise and tenon fixing structure. Limiting blocks and damping blocks are set at the connection points to improve stability and absorb vibration energy.
It improves the vibration reduction capability of the track bed resonator, enhances the vibration control and noise reduction effect of the rail transit system, and improves the system stability and passenger comfort.
